[GELÖST] Dovecot: "user unknown"

C

CrimsonKing

Guest
Tach auch,

ich habe jüngst meinen alten Debianserver (rosaelef*nten.org) durch 'n FreeBSD ersetzt. Den Mailserver wollte ich diesmal via SSL betreiben.Dafür hab' ich mich an diese Anleitung gehalten.

Ich kann mich auch als root@rosaelef*nten.org anmelden:

17.04.2013, 17:07:07: IMAP - Authentifiziere (Benutzer: "root@rosaelef*nten.org", Methode: "LOGIN")...
17.04.2013, 17:07:07: IMAP - IMAP-Server Authentifikation OK - IMAP-Server meldet: "Logged in"

Wenn ich aber eine Mail an diese Adresse senden möchte, bekomme ich sie als "user unknown" zurück. Jemand eine Idee?
 
Zuletzt bearbeitet von einem Moderator:
Dovecot ist nur ein MDA kein MTA. Du musst also bei der Konfiguration deines MTAs nachsehen wieso du keine Mails für den User zustellen kannst.
 
Das maillog sagt:

dovecot: auth(default): prefetch(root@rosaelef*nten.org): userdb lookup not possible with only userdb prefetch

Offenbar leitet Dovecot das bereits falsch an Postfix weiter...?
 
Zuletzt bearbeitet von einem Moderator:
Bin 'nen Schritt weiter.

Code:
Apr 17 18:02:38 rosaelefanten dovecot: auth(default): pgsql: Connected to mail
Apr 17 18:02:38 rosaelefanten dovecot: auth(default): sql(root@rosaelefanten.org): User query failed: FEHLER:  Relation »users« existiert nicht
Apr 17 18:02:38 rosaelefanten dovecot: auth(default): LINE 1: SELECT home, uid, gid FROM users WHERE username = 'root' AND...
Apr 17 18:02:38 rosaelefanten dovecot: auth(default):                                    ^

Preisfrage: Wo holt der das Query her? In der dovecot-sql.conf steht es nicht.

Nachtrag: Korrigiert - das user_query muss man offenbar verpflichtend angeben. Nun gut.
Ich hoffe, das muss ich nicht mehr allzu oft machen. Geht nun jedenfalls. Vorerst.
 
Zuletzt bearbeitet von einem Moderator:
Unter Debian war das einfacher, unter FreeBSD brauchte ich das bisher nicht, hatte ja schon einen unter Debian ...

Learning by doing. Tja.
 
Zurück
Oben